Road cycling routes around Coutures traverse a landscape characterized by rolling countryside and agricultural lands. The region features a network of roads that follow river valleys, such as the Gimone, and canal paths, including the Moissac Canal. Elevation gains vary, offering routes from gentle gradients to more challenging climbs over low hills. This area provides diverse terrain suitable for various road cycling preferences.

There are over 120 road cycling routes around Coutures, offering a wide range of options for different skill levels and preferences. The komoot community has explored these routes extensively, contributing to their high average rating.
Road cycling routes around Coutures feature a landscape of rolling countryside and agricultural lands. You'll find a network of roads following river valleys, such as the Gimone, and canal paths, including the Moissac Canal. Elevation gains vary, from gentle gradients to more challenging climbs over low hills.
Yes, Coutures offers several easy road cycling routes perfect for beginners. For instance, the Roadbike loop from Lavit is an accessible 25.1-mile (40.4 km) trail with minimal elevation gain, providing a pleasant introduction to the area's cycling.
For those seeking a challenge, Coutures has routes with significant elevation changes. The Village of Larrazet – Faudoas loop from Lavit is a difficult 53.9-mile (86.7 km) route featuring nearly 1,000 meters of ascent, ideal for advanced cyclists.
Many of the road cycling routes in Coutures are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end in the same location. Examples include the popular Village of Larrazet loop from Lavit and the Gimone loop from Lavit, both offering varied scenery on a circular path.
The spring and autumn months generally offer the most pleasant conditions for road cycling in Coutures, with milder temperatures and beautiful scenery. Summer can be warm, while winter cycling is possible but may require appropriate gear for cooler, potentially wetter weather.
The komoot community highly rates road cycling in Coutures, with an average score of 4.4 stars from 23 reviews. Cyclists often praise the diverse terrain, from gentle river valleys to challenging hills, and the peaceful rural roads that characterize the region.
Yes, the region around Coutures includes routes that utilize canal paths. The Moissac – Moissac Canal loop from Lavit is a great option for experiencing cycling along the tranquil Moissac Canal, offering a relatively flat and scenic ride.
For a moderate challenge, consider routes like the Village of Larrazet loop from Lavit, which is 31.8 miles (51.2 km) with moderate elevation changes, or the Gimone loop from Lavit, a 33.9-mile (54.6 km) trail through the scenic Gimone river valley.
Many routes in Coutures will take you through charming rural villages, offering a glimpse into local life. The Village of Larrazet loop from Lavit is a prime example, featuring varied terrain and passing directly through several such communities.
